Preview: Memphis Grizzlies vs Detroit Pistons

Hopefully the collective blood pressure of Grizz Nation has returned to normal, as tonight in the Grindhouse our Memphis Grizzlies will face off against the Detroit Pistons.
The Grizzlies have won 9 of the last 10 matchups against the Pistons since the 2009-2010 season, but that is no reason for Memphis to be complacent against a Detroit team that will be looking to continue the momentum that lead them to defeat the Oklahoma City Thunder in overtime last night.

After clawing their way back Thursday night from a 26 point deficit to beat the Kings by one with Courtney Lee’s incredible buzzer beater, the Grizzlies need to come out swinging tonight. While I am certainly happy that we were able to pull out the win, there was still much to be desired about the performance we saw from the team in the first half.
Moving forward, from the opening tip to the final buzzer, focus should be on playing strong on both ends of the court and preventing teams from piling up a double digit lead that we have to scramble to overcome. After being out rebounded 44-30 on Thursday night, tonight we need to do a better job of attacking the glass and grabbing boards on both ends of the floor.

While I am not ready to definitively declare that the early season slump our bench has been in is over, there has certainly been much improvement, especially Thursday night against Sacramento, when the bench delivered a season high of 50 points. This is the sort of effort we need to see from the reserves on a more consistent basis, the starters alone cannot continue to carry the rest of the team.

Speaking of the starters, it would be great to see a return of the aggressive Marc Gasol who featured prominently in the first few games of the season. When Marc is in beast mode and we run the offense through him, this team is an even greater force to be reckoned with.
